Postcode coverage in Lewisham

Lewisham town centre is in the SE13 postcode district, which includes the town centre itself, Hither Green, and Ladywell. SE13 is well connected by rail (Lewisham station serves Southeastern and DLR services) and sits at the junction of several major A-roads serving south-east London.

Non-fault accident support in Lewisham

Lewisham is the principal town centre of the London Borough of Lewisham, with a major shopping centre (Lewisham Shopping Centre), a large bus terminus at Lewisham station, and a transport interchange combining DLR, Southeastern rail, and National Rail services. The town's road network converges at Lewisham High Street and the roundabout junction of the A20, A21 approach roads, and Lee High Road, making Lewisham one of the busiest road junctions in south-east London.

The A20 runs through Lewisham on its course from London Bridge toward Sidcup and the M20. Through the town centre the A20 takes the form of Lewisham High Street and Lee High Road, and it carries the full weight of traffic moving between the inner south-east and the Medway towns and Kent coast. The Lee Green roundabout, where the A20 meets Lee High Road, Manor Lane, and the approach from Blackheath, is one of the higher-volume junctions in the borough and generates a consistent pattern of roundabout entry and priority incidents.

The DLR extension to Lewisham opened in 1999 and has since grown significantly in use, with the station functioning as a major interchange between rail, DLR, and bus services. The station forecourt and the bus terminus opposite are sources of significant pedestrian footfall, and incidents in the station area involve a combination of commuter pedestrian movements, taxis, PHVs, and bus manoeuvres in a compact space.

Traffic and road conditions in Lewisham

Lewisham High Street A20 is 30mph and carries very high northbound and southbound volumes throughout the day. Bus routes 21, 47, 75, 122, 136, 181, 185, 199, 202, 208, 261, 273, 284, 321, and more serve the town, making Lewisham bus station one of the highest-frequency bus interchanges in south London. The junction of Lewisham High Street with Loampit Vale and Rennell Street at the station end of the town centre is the primary pedestrian and vehicle conflict zone.

The A21 from Lewisham toward Bromley and the M25 begins at the Lewisham junction and carries the primary south-east corridor traffic out of the town. This road transitions from a 30mph urban arterial in Lewisham to a 40mph and eventually 50mph road as it enters Bromley. The junction of the A21 with the A20 Lee High Road at Lee Green is the point where the traffic splits between the Kent and Bromley directions.

How we handle Lewisham accident claims

CCTV in Lewisham town centre is operated by the London Borough of Lewisham's safer-streets system. TfL holds cameras on the A20 and A21. DLR station cameras (TfL Rail) cover the station approaches. Bus CCTV from the numerous routes is a significant secondary source. We request all relevant authorities simultaneously at file opening.

Lewisham's position as a bus terminus means that bus-involved claims are disproportionately common here. The bus station area and the routes leading to and from it - Lewisham Way, Loampit Vale, and Lewisham Road - are recurring sources of bus stop and bus manoeuvre claims.

Evidence and disclosure timeline in Lewisham

CCTV, signal data and bus footage from a Lewisham collision are subject to retention windows that typically run between 14 and 31 days. After that the footage is overwritten and unavailable. The first 72 hours are disproportionately important.

  1. 0hMake the scene safe, exchange details, photograph the road layout, call 999 if anyone is injured. The Road Traffic Act 1988 duty to give details applies at the scene.
  2. 1hOpen the claim with us. We dispatch recovery to Lewisham and start drafting the disclosure requests to the correct highway authority.
  3. 24hIf reportable, file with the Metropolitan Police via the MPS Collision Reporting Service online. Quote the CRIS reference in all insurer correspondence.
  4. 72hCCTV disclosure request lodged with the London Borough of Lewisham Information Governance team and, where relevant, TfL and National Highways.
  5. 14-31dStandard CCTV retention window. After this, footage is routinely overwritten unless preserved on an open disclosure request. We track the retention window for every claim from intake.

A bus exiting Lewisham bus station hit my car - who do I claim against?
You claim against the bus operator's insurer. We identify the route operator from the route number, send the bus CCTV preservation request to TfL (who control the bus station footage) and the operator simultaneously, and pursue the claim at no upfront cost.
My accident was at Lee Green roundabout - who holds the CCTV?
The A20 and A21 at Lee Green roundabout are TfL Road Network roads. TfL holds the CCTV. We submit the TfL preservation request within 48 hours.
